Last Wednesday afternoon I took a moment to stop by the water so that I could just breathe and thank God for his goodness. I had been clinging to Psalm 23:6 NIV for several months now; “Surely your goodness and love will follow me all the days of my life, and I will dwell in the house of the Lord forever.” In the previous weeks an Aunt had sent me a card with this verse, not knowing it was one I had been praying over. To share in the goodness of God, He answered prayer that day. A prayer where I would wake up early each morning and my first breath was a surrender to God. A prayer where every night I would lay my head on the pillow thanking God for His goodness and grace. That particular Wednesday I received good news that biopsies I had taken the week before were all normal.

This isn’t the end of my health journey but the beginning of something good. I can sing the goodness of God with every breath that I am able. In this song, Goodness of God by Bethel Music, with my life laid down, I surrender now. On this Thankful Thursday, will you choose to thank God for the goodness in your life? Will you choose to surrender everything over to Him? I encourage you to write this verse down and share it with someone who needs to know God is good.

As I ran last night, I was blessed to watch the sun color the sky with amazing colors as it set. I am directionally challenged but if I stay near the ocean coast it makes it easier to know my North, East, West, and South. I remember as a child having to memorize, “Never Eat Sour Watermelons”. Although this picture isn’t turning North, it reminded me of Deuteronomy 2:1-3 NIV as I was finishing up mile four. God is talking to the Israelites about how they have wondered long enough;

“Then we turned back and set out toward the wilderness along the route to the Red Sea, as the Lord had directed me. For a long time we made our way around the hill country of Seir. Then the Lord said to me, “You have made your way around this hill country long enough; now turn north.”

On this Transformation Tips Tuesday, I want us to take inventory. Is there an area in our lives we feel like we are wondering in the wilderness. Maybe our minds are clouded with where to turn next. It would be amazing if we could get an audible direction like, just turn North. I know God talks to me clearly through his word, through people He has placed in my life, and through God winks. I encourage us to be more intentional to hear and see God throughout our day.

If God asks us to turn North, will we follow? Or will we stay wondering because that is comfortable?

Many of us in South Carolina got up early to experience the beautiful snow falling effortlessly from the sky. Although it didn’t last long, it was enjoyable. My daughter snapped this photo of her foot prints and reminded me of how God often Carries us.

“Even to your old age and gray hairs I am he, I am he who will sustain you. I have made you and I will carry you; I will sustain you and I will rescue you.” Is‬ ‭46:4‬ ‭NIV‬‬

Of course there are many stories of how God rescues us. We read in Matthew chapter 18, verses 10-14, the parable of the lost sheep. God will leave the 99 so that he can rescue 1. The image of him carrying us as little lambs so effortlessly because of the loving father He is.

“He tends his flock like a shepherd: He gathers the lambs in his arms and carries them close to his heart; he gently leads those that have young.” Is‬ ‭40:11‬ ‭NIV‬‬

God is in the rescue business. You may not need rescuing today. Maybe God has placed you in someone’s life to be a vessel. On this Spiritual Sunday, picture yourself as a little lamb resting in God’s loving arms. Thank Him for the unconditional love He so freely gives. Ask God to carry you through this week so that you can be a vessel to the 1 in need of a rescue.

There are several of us doing a health challenge so that we can kick off 2022 as a healthier version of ourselves. Not so much a diet but a lifestyle change. It is teaching us to eat fruits and veggies, drink plenty of water, not to eat after 8:00pm, get our bodies moving for 30-45 minutes a day, read scripture, do good deeds, and encourage one another. Sounds easy enough, right? How often do we sin? Our answer should be daily, if not minute by minute. We are reminded in 1 Cor 6:19-20 NIV that our bodies are temples for God; 19 Do you not know that your bodies are temples of the Holy Spirit, who is in you, whom you have received from God? You are not your own; 20 you were bought at a price. Therefore honor God with your bodies.

How do we keep forgetting the simplicity of these two verses? In this song Resurrender by Hillsong, some of the lyrics sing; “If your calling, we’re coming. We’re not walking, we’re running. God we need resurrender”.

That’s it! We must daily, if not minute by minute keep resurrendering ourselves over to God. On this finish Friday, let’s make a commitment to finish the week strong. Let’s not wait till Monday because every day we are to be a temple for God. We should be as excited as my jump shot photo to strive after what God desires of us; to be temples for His glory.
